在数字化转型的浪潮中,自主智能体(Autonomous Agent)技术正逐渐成为企业提升效率、优化决策的核心驱动力。自主智能体是一种能够感知环境、自主决策并执行任务的智能系统,广泛应用于数据中台、数字孪生、数字可视化等领域。本文将深入解析自主智能体的技术实现与算法设计,为企业和个人提供实用的指导。
一、什么是自主智能体?
自主智能体是指能够在动态环境中感知信息、自主决策并执行任务的智能系统。它具备以下核心特征:
- 自主性:无需外部干预,能够独立完成任务。
- 反应性:能够实时感知环境变化并做出响应。
- 目标导向:具备明确的目标,并通过决策和行动实现目标。
- 学习能力:能够通过经验优化自身行为。
自主智能体的应用场景广泛,包括智能制造、智慧城市、金融投资、物流运输等领域。例如,在智能制造中,自主智能体可以用于设备故障预测和自主修复;在智慧城市中,它可以优化交通流量和资源分配。
二、自主智能体的核心技术
要实现自主智能体,需要结合多种技术手段。以下是其核心技术的详细解析:
1. 感知技术
感知是自主智能体与环境交互的第一步。通过感知技术,智能体能够获取环境中的信息,例如图像、声音、传感器数据等。常用的技术包括:
- 计算机视觉:通过摄像头和深度学习算法,识别图像中的物体、场景和行为。
- 自然语言处理:通过语音识别和语义理解,与人类进行对话交互。
- 传感器技术:通过温度、湿度、压力等传感器,获取物理环境的数据。
2. 决策技术
在感知环境的基础上,自主智能体需要做出决策。决策技术的核心是算法设计,包括以下几种:
- 强化学习:通过试错机制,学习最优策略。例如,在游戏中,智能体通过不断尝试不同的动作,最终找到获胜的策略。
- 决策树:通过构建树状结构,分析不同决策的后果,选择最优路径。
- 贝叶斯网络:通过概率推理,评估不同决策的风险和收益。
3. 执行技术
决策完成后,自主智能体需要通过执行技术将决策转化为实际操作。执行技术包括:
- 机器人控制:通过电机和舵机,控制机器人的运动和操作。
- 自动化系统:通过PLC(可编程逻辑控制器)和SCADA(数据采集与监控系统),实现工业设备的自动化控制。
- 人机交互:通过触摸屏、语音助手等界面,与人类进行交互。
4. 学习技术
自主智能体需要通过学习不断优化自身性能。学习技术包括:
- 监督学习:通过标注数据,训练模型识别模式。
- 无监督学习:通过聚类和降维技术,发现数据中的隐藏结构。
- 迁移学习:将已有的知识迁移到新的任务中,减少训练数据的需求。
三、自主智能体的算法设计
算法设计是自主智能体实现的核心环节。以下是几种常见的算法及其应用场景:
1. 强化学习
强化学习是一种通过试错机制优化决策的算法。智能体通过与环境交互,获得奖励或惩罚,并根据奖励信号调整策略。强化学习广泛应用于游戏AI、机器人控制等领域。
- 马尔可夫决策过程(MDP):将环境建模为状态、动作、奖励和转移概率的组合。
- 深度强化学习(Deep RL):结合深度学习和强化学习,处理高维状态空间。
2. 图神经网络
图神经网络(Graph Neural Network, GNN)是一种处理图结构数据的深度学习算法。它在社交网络分析、推荐系统、分子结构预测等领域有广泛应用。
- 图卷积网络(GCN):通过局部聚合和传播,学习节点特征。
- 图注意力网络(GAT):通过注意力机制,捕捉节点之间的长距离依赖。
3. 生成对抗网络
生成对抗网络(Generative Adversarial Network, GAN)是一种通过对抗训练生成高质量数据的算法。它在图像生成、语音合成、数据增强等领域有广泛应用。
- 生成器:通过深度神经网络,生成逼真的数据。
- 判别器:通过深度神经网络,区分生成数据和真实数据。
四、自主智能体的应用场景
自主智能体技术已在多个领域得到广泛应用,以下是几个典型场景:
1. 智能制造
在智能制造中,自主智能体可以用于设备故障预测、生产优化和质量控制。例如,通过传感器数据和机器学习算法,智能体可以预测设备的故障时间,并提前安排维护。
2. 智慧城市
在智慧城市中,自主智能体可以用于交通管理、能源优化和公共安全。例如,通过实时交通数据和强化学习算法,智能体可以优化交通信号灯的控制,减少拥堵。
3. 金融投资
在金融领域,自主智能体可以用于股票交易、风险管理和投资组合优化。例如,通过历史数据和强化学习算法,智能体可以制定最优的交易策略。
五、自主智能体的挑战与未来方向
尽管自主智能体技术发展迅速,但仍面临一些挑战:
1. 数据问题
- 数据质量:噪声数据会影响模型的性能。
- 数据隐私:如何在保护隐私的前提下,利用数据进行训练。
2. 算法问题
- 算法复杂度:复杂算法需要大量计算资源。
- 算法可解释性:如何让人类理解算法的决策过程。
3. 计算资源
- 算力需求:深度学习算法需要高性能计算设备。
- 能耗问题:高能耗算法可能不适用于移动设备。
4. 伦理问题
- 决策透明性:如何确保智能体的决策过程透明。
- 责任归属:当智能体造成损害时,责任应由谁承担。
未来,自主智能体技术将朝着以下几个方向发展:
- 边缘计算:通过边缘计算,减少对云端的依赖,提高实时性。
- 人机协作:通过人机协作,充分发挥人类和智能体的优势。
- 多智能体系统:通过多智能体协作,解决复杂问题。
六、申请试用,开启智能体之旅
如果您对自主智能体技术感兴趣,可以申请试用相关产品,深入了解其功能和应用。通过实践,您将能够更好地理解自主智能体的技术实现与算法设计。
申请试用
七、结语
自主智能体技术是人工智能领域的前沿方向,其应用前景广阔。通过本文的解析,您应该能够理解自主智能体的核心技术、算法设计及其应用场景。如果您希望进一步了解或尝试自主智能体技术,不妨申请试用相关产品,开启您的智能体之旅。
申请试用
希望本文对您有所帮助!如果需要进一步探讨或技术支持,请随时联系我们。
申请试用
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。